Now, let's dive into our Weather Playbook segment. Today, we're talking about microbursts - those tiny but mighty thunderstorm downdrafts that can create intense, localized wind damage. Imagine a weather temper tantrum concentrated in one small area. These bad boys can produce wind speeds over 100 miles per hour in just a few seconds!
